    I realized that powered.....png and powered.gif should be placed in /includes/images folder regardless of teh fact that system uses them from cache too.
    However, logo was visible all teh time because it is not intention to remove powered by Sugar icon. Just above below Welcom it may be good to put logo of comapny that welcomes its workers to enter CRM.
    When I copied them to
    /includes/images folder notice on licence violation disappeared.
